About 117a
117a is a semi-detached house in Wolverhampton (WV3 9NJ). It has a recorded floor area of 39 m² (around 420 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(April 2021) shows a D (score 62),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in February 2009 the rating was G, the property has climbed 3 bands since.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Very Poor to Good; while main heating dropped from Poor to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 78). Main heating runs on electricity. At 39 m² this is the 30th smallest of 55 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 13–107 m². The building's EPC ratings span E to C across 55 units on file.
Across 2008–2022, sale prices on this property compounded at 2.2%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£200,000 is 27.3% below the 2022 sale of £275,000, running counter to the wider postcode trend, which makes the EPC and condition history especially worth a look.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£655/sq ft) was about 28.8%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Sold April 2022 for £275,000.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
